Output 943ad3d2c3de1c67d5bb858b591b41be205c7100c06294d80703db1ba73bc65f:1

value
87427054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b19b2d8931097fe2d5f5e5931eb4558d687cc2 OP_EQUAL
address
3LzMGK5hKxRU5MwJfFgZuWvFdvwEzqhXPK
transaction
943ad3d2c3de1c67d5bb858b591b41be205c7100c06294d80703db1ba73bc65f
confirmations
521897
spent
true